How to Stay Informed and Report Incidents
Okay, so how do you actually stay in the loop and report stuff? Here's the lowdown. Firstly, follow the Pseithamesse Valley Police's official channels. This usually includes their website and social media accounts. They often post updates, safety tips, and alerts directly to these platforms, so it’s a quick and easy way to get the latest info. Also, make sure to sign up for local news alerts. Many local news outlets offer email or text alerts that will notify you about breaking news, crime updates, and other important information. This is a super convenient way to stay informed without having to constantly check the news. Having these alerts will let you know about any immediate threats or significant developments in your area, letting you take appropriate measures.
Now, about reporting incidents. If you see something, say something! You can report non-emergency incidents through the police's website or by calling the non-emergency number. For emergencies, always dial 999. The police encourage the community to report all suspicious activity, no matter how small it may seem. Even seemingly minor incidents can provide vital information. Make sure you have all the necessary details. Provide as much information as possible when reporting an incident. This includes the date, time, location, description of the incident, and any other relevant details that could help the police. Also, always remember that your report is confidential, so you can report the incident without fear of your name being shared. Reporting helps the police to identify crime patterns and take appropriate action. They are also there to assist you and provide any necessary support or guidance.
